Flatiron Energy has received approval from ISO New England for a 300-MW/1,200-MWh battery energy storage system in Boston, Massachusetts.
Here are some key points to consider: Enhanced Grid Stability: The 300-MW/1,200-MWh capacity of the battery storage system is expected to improve grid reliability and stability, particularly during peak demand times or unexpected outages. This helps to stabilize the electricity supply in the Greater Boston area.
